Bus Aid:
This position supervises students at the bus stop at morning arrival and afternoon dismissal; assists in providing safe and efficient transportation for special education students in order that they may be able to take full advantage of the education program and process.
10 month - 6 hours/day
$15.15 - 15.96/hour + Benefits
All P.U.S.D. employees must have an IVP fingerprint card.
All Full time (6 or more hours per day) PUSD employees receive the following benefits in addition to their salary or hourly pay.
*Candidates receiving Arizona State Retirement are welcome to apply. If selected for a posted position candidate may be employed through a third party employer, Educational Services, Inc.
**4-6 hour employees (20-29 hours a week):
PUSD will pay 50% of premiums for our Medical Insurance Plan.
Arizona State Retirement System; district matches employee contributions (appx 12%)
Generous sick leave plan
12 month employees receive generous annual leave
